Paula Cooper, a paralegal from Georgetown, SC, gets in over her head while working for an attorney, Thomas Denby, when she is asked to participate in a plot to blackmail a federal judge. Paula goes to Judge Parks’ annual Christmas party in Charleston, SC, where she is to entice the separated judge into an embrace in his bedroom, but before she can complete her mission, things go terribly wrong.
The love of Paula’s boyfriend, Jim Roberts, an antique dealer whom she met at the Isle of Palms the previous summer, is tested because of what she has done. She is confronted with the possibility of losing her special man, as well as faces criminal charges.
The FBI investigative team of John Dibbs and Albert Mendez are assigned the case and discover that there are many possible suspects in a double murder. The twists and turns are numerous as they attempt to capture an elusive assassin within the picturesque, “holy city” of Charleston. Paula seeks to redeem herself from a bad decision, as someone attempts to kill her.
Paula Roberts Private Investigator – Johns Island (Sequel to The Paralegal) (Book 2)
Thousands of readers who have expressed an interest in a sequel are now reading this exciting novel. Released in 2013, many readers are enjoying it as much as, if not more, than the first of Mr. Easterling’s novel in this trilogy.
Paula has moved on in her career becoming a private detective for Crescent Moon Agency working alongside a former Navy Seal, Russ Baxter. She is a natural for the position and settles into her new role helping solve tough cases in and around Charleston. She is instrumental in helping trouble families who find themselves in the middle of pending divorces, drug smuggling operations, and the kidnapping of a young boy. Will this be a career that she can hold on to, or will it proved to be more dangerous than she ever imagined?
Paula Roberts Private Investigator – Cayman Islands (Sequel to Paula Roberts P.I.-Johns Island) (Book 3)
After two years on the job as a P. I., Paula is faced with a decision that she dreads. She loves her work as a sleuth and has made a positive impact on communities Charleston just doing her job and being who she is. However, when a dangerous case brings peril to her doorsteps, endangering the lives of her family, she has to decide to continue her work, or lay it down.
As, she contemplates this decision, Paula takes on a new case, which proves to be the most dangerous ever. She goes to the Caymans Islands in search of proof of life on a missing man. Tagging along with her is a college student who works at Crescent Moon Agency as a receptionist, and gets caught up in a complex plot. Paula and Carla find themselves out on the water in a speedboat following a hired killer who is not only attempting to dispose of his target, but turns on Paula and her assistant to eliminate them from interfering with his pay day. Will Paula and Carla survive? Will they find the missing man? Suspenseful action in speedboats throughout the cave system of Cayman Brac develops, as Paula seeks to accomplish her mission.
